The Importance of Upgrade Path Planning
An effective upgrade path allows organizations to smoothly transition from older to newer systems without significant disruptions. It helps in maintaining compatibility, security, and performance over time. Without a clear plan, companies risk facing costly downtimes and technical debt.
Key Strategies for Designing Upgrade Paths
1. Modular Architecture
Design systems with modular components that can be upgraded independently. This approach minimizes the impact of updates and allows for targeted improvements.
2. Compatibility and Standards
Ensure that new upgrades adhere to industry standards and are compatible with existing infrastructure. This reduces integration issues and future-proof your systems.
3. Phased Implementation
Implement upgrades in phases to monitor effects and address issues incrementally. This strategy helps in managing risks and maintaining operational continuity.
Benefits of a Well-Defined Upgrade Path
- Extended System Lifespan: Regular upgrades prolong the usability of your systems.
- Cost Efficiency: Phased upgrades reduce unforeseen expenses and resource spikes.
- Enhanced Security: Staying current with updates mitigates vulnerabilities.
- Flexibility and Scalability: A strategic upgrade path supports future growth and technological advancements.
Challenges and How to Overcome Them
1. Compatibility Issues
Thorough testing and adherence to standards can minimize compatibility problems during upgrades.
2. Downtime Risks
Implement phased upgrades and maintain backup plans to reduce the impact of potential downtimes.
3. Budget Constraints
Prioritize upgrades based on critical needs and plan budgets accordingly to ensure continuous progress.
